I've got a 95 GMC Sonoma with 162,000 miles on it when shifting out of 4 high while driving down the road it takes awhile for it to disengage. When it does disengage there is a loud/hard bang like when you hit a pothole. When driving in 4 high the whole truck vibrates at speeds over 40mph and it handles weird I don't really know how to explain it but it kinda pulls you around... The truck has a manual transmission and its not the push button 4wd it has the manual lever on the floor. When its not in 4 high it drives perfectly fine

I've had the truck for 5yrs and use the 4wd often especially in winter and have never had any problems before. Any ideas as to whats causing this??

Check all front drive shaft splines and joints.
Check front axel shafts.
Check fluid level.

Is all tires a matched set?
Have you checked tires and rims for bad tire or bent rim?
Any mudd stuck on/in wheels?

On shifting if you stop and go to neutral or back up a little will it come out of 4W ok?
And shift in good?

Does all 4W position lights work good?


Never operate it in 4W on dry payment.


Any viberation in 2W drive?

Has front or back rear end been worked on?
